What is a Lead Funnel?
A lead funnel maps the customer journey from awareness to decision. A well-optimized funnel increases conversions and reduces marketing costs.

Stages of the Funnel

Awareness

Blog posts, social media content, paid ads

Interest

Lead magnets, email sign-ups, webinars

Consideration

Case studies, demos, nurturing emails

Conversion

Free trials, discounts, strong CTAs

Tools You’ll Need

Website builder (e.g., WordPress, Webflow)

Email marketing platform (Mailchimp, Brevo)

Landing page builder (Unbounce, Leadpages)

CRM (HubSpot, Zoho)

Analytics (Google Analytics, Hotjar)

Email Sequences that Nurture

Welcome Email → Value Email → Soft Sell → Hard Sell
